1. Short Title.
- This Scheme may be called the Mukhya Mantri Swavlamban Yojana, 2019.2. Commencement and duration of the Scheme.
-This Scheme has come into effect from 9th February, 2019 and shall remain in force up to such date as the State Government by a notification in the official Gazette prescribe.3. Definitions.
- (i) "Bonafide Himachali" means a resident of the State of Himachal Pradesh as defined by the State Government from time to time.4. Applicability of the Scheme.
-(i) The Scheme is applicable to the youth of Himachal Pradesh, who are of the age of 18 years or more and upto the age of 45 years at the time of filling the common application form on the Departmental website, intending to set up new industrial units within the State.5. Negative List.
- The negative industries as notified at Annexure-III of the "Rules Regarding Grant of Incentives, Concessions and Facilities to industrial units in Himachal, 2004" as amended from time to time by the Industries Department will not be eligible for subsidy under this Scheme.8.
Plant and machinery, for which payment has been made in cash, would not be eligible for consideration of the subsidy. Expenditure on second hand plant and machinery would be considered only after getting the value of Plant and machinery assessed by Chartered Engineer (Mechanical) that the productive life of such second hand machinery in at least five years and payment of such machinery has not been made through cash.9.
A unit can avail subsidy only under a single Scheme, either from the Central Government or from the State Government. A unit seeking subsidy should self certify that it has not obtained or applied for subsidy for the same purpose or activity from any other Ministry or Department of the Government of India or State Government.10. Designated agency for disbursement of subsidy.
- The Joint Director of Industries/Deputy Director of Industries/General Manager, District Industries Centre Himachal Pradesh shall be the designated agency for disbursement of incentives as defined under this Scheme. However incentive for leasing of Government land other than land in industrial areas/Industrial estates would be provided by the concerned Department after issuance of separate notification in this regard.11. Rights of the State Government/Financial Institutions.
- If State Government/ Financial Institutions concerned is satisfied that the subsidy or grant to an industrial unit has been obtained by misrepresenting an essential fact, furnishing of false information or if the unit goes out of commercial production/operation within 03 years after commencement of Commercial Production the unit would be liable to refund the grant or subsidy after being given an opportunity of being heard failing which recovery would be made as arrears of Land Revenue. In case Government land is given on lease under this Scheme and such Enterprise gives false information, such land would be immediately resumed and penalty would be imposed on the premium (Prevalent at the time of allotment) @ 12 % penal interest from the date of leasing out till the payment is made. The decision of Secretary (Industries) would be final in this regard.12.
No owner of an industrial unit after receiving a part or the whole of the grant or subsidy will be allowed to change the location of the whole or any part of industrial unit or effect any substantial contraction or disposal of a substantial part of its total fixed capital investment within a period of 5 years after its going into commercial production/operation without taking prior approval of the Director of Industries, Himachal Pradesh.13.
100. % physical verification of the actual establishment and working status of units availing subsidy under the Scheme will be done by State Government through District Industries Centers. District Industries Centers shall submit Annual Report to the Directorate of Industries about the functioning of the units. After receiving the grant or subsidy, each industrial unit shall also submit Annual Progress Report to the District Industries Centre with a copy to Director Industries.
